I'm trying to install WinNT on Virtual PC 6.x.
During installation I am required to press the PageDown key to agree to
continue with the install.
But when I press the Page Down key on my PowerBook 15", absolutely nothing
happens. Zilch. Nada.
Any suggestions - other than installin Windows 2000 instead of WinNT - are
welcome.
I can't tell you how frustrating this is.

Are you remembering to press the function key (fn) as you hit the pg dn key?
Or, on your keyboard, does (num lock) have to be off to enable the page down
key?
Hitting Page Down works fine in VPC.

Try pressing Return or try fn + page down (forgot which worked). But
when prompted to press cntl+alt+delete you will need to include fn key
when starting up. NT4 works well, keep trying.
